Assistant Varsity Wrestling Coach Okemos Public Schools - 4.4 Okemos, MI Job Details Seasonal 1 day ago Qualifications Sports coaching First aid Wrestling High school diploma or GED Team motivation (leadership skill) Safety protocol implementation Full Job Description Job Summary Okemos High School is seeking a dedicated and passionate individual to join our athletic department as an Assistant Varsity Wrestling Coach for the upcoming season.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in wrestling, a commitment to student-athlete development, and the ability to foster a positive and competitive team environment. This seasonal position will support the head coach in all aspects of the wrestling program, ensuring a successful and enriching experience for our student-athletes. Responsibilities Assist the head coach in planning and implementing practice sessions, drills, and strategies to enhance team performance. Provide instruction and support to student-athletes in skill development, technique, and sportsmanship. Help organize and supervise team activities, including competitions, tournaments, and fundraising events. Monitor the academic progress and overall well-being of student-athletes, promoting a balanced approach to athletics and academics. Collaborate with the head coach to evaluate individual and team performance, providing constructive feedback for improvement. Assist in the recruitment and retention of student-athletes, fostering a welcoming and inclusive team culture. Ensure compliance with all relevant athletic regulations and guidelines, including safety protocols and eligibility requirements. Communicate effectively with athletes, parents, and school administration regarding team updates, schedules, and expectations. Attend coaching clinics and workshops to stay updated on best practices and developments in the sport. Requirements Previous experience in wrestling as a coach, athlete, or official, with a strong understanding of the sport's techniques and strategies. Excellent commun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to motivate and inspire student-athletes. Strong organizational skills and the ability to manage multiple tasks effectively. A commitment to promoting a positive and inclusive team environment. Knowledge of safety protocols and first aid procedures related to wrestling. Ability to work flexible hours, including evenings and weekends, during the wrestling season. CPR and First Aid certification preferred, or willingness to obtain certification prior to the start of the season. A high school diploma or equivalent; a college degree in a related field is a plus.
